In San Leandro, per-diem radiologic technologist and technician pay often falls between $40 and $60 per hour, with cross-trained specialists in CT or MRI earning even more, approximately $50 to $75 hourly. Those in travel contracts can see weekly rates that range from $1,800 to $2,800. Variable pay across different employer types—like urgent care vs. hospital imaging departments—often leads to a trade-off between benefits and hourly rates. Workers may choose positions with less pay in exchange for health insurance. Negotiations for hourly rates are key; having knowledge of local pay standards and being prepared to discuss modality expertise can lead to better offers.

Do radiologic technologists and technicians earn more per hour working part-time in San Leandro?

Part-time and per diem radiologic technologists and technicians in San Leandro sometimes command higher hourly rates — up to $83.15/hour — because practices need flexible coverage for specific days or peak hours. However, part-time positions typically do not include benefits like health insurance, paid time off, or retirement contributions. When factoring in the value of benefits, full-time salaried positions may offer comparable or better total compensation despite a slightly lower hourly rate.
